色婷婷狠狠18禁久久YY,CHINESE性内射高清国产,国产女人18毛片水真多1,国产AV在线观看

mysql update @value

MySQL中update語(yǔ)句用于修改表中的記錄,update操作通常需要設(shè)置需要更新的字段名和字段的新值。使用“@value”能夠在update語(yǔ)句中幫助我們更靈活地實(shí)現(xiàn)更新操作。

例子:
UPDATE `students` SET `score` = `score` + @value WHERE `id` = 1;

上面的例子中,我們更新了“students”表中id為1的記錄的分?jǐn)?shù)(score)值,將其加上了一個(gè)由“@value”代表的值。也就是說(shuō)我們使用了一個(gè)變量“@value”來(lái)實(shí)現(xiàn)這個(gè)數(shù)值的更新。

在update語(yǔ)句中,“@value”可以代表任意的值,比如數(shù)字、字符串等等。實(shí)現(xiàn)起來(lái)也很簡(jiǎn)單,只需要在update語(yǔ)句外面使用一個(gè)set命令即可定義變量“@value”的值:

例子:
SET @value = 10;
UPDATE `students` SET `score` = `score` + @value WHERE `id` = 1;

在上面的例子中,我們通過(guò)set命令將變量“@value”設(shè)為10,然后在update語(yǔ)句中使用該變量修改了某個(gè)學(xué)生的分?jǐn)?shù)值。當(dāng)然,我們也可以將變量“@value”設(shè)為其他的值:

例子:
SET @value = 20;
UPDATE `students` SET `score` = `score` - @value WHERE `id` = 2;

上面的例子中,我們將變量“@value”設(shè)為20,然后使用該變量從表“students”的id為2的記錄的分?jǐn)?shù)值中減去了這個(gè)數(shù)值。

可以看到,“@value”變量的使用讓update語(yǔ)句更加具有靈活性,我們可以輕松地修改任意表中的記錄,只需在update語(yǔ)句中使用該變量即可實(shí)現(xiàn)目標(biāo)。